HOLLAND HOUSE® LEMON CHICKEN SALAD

Simmering the chicken in cooking wine adds lots of flavor to this refreshing main dish salad.

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 10

½ cup Holland House® White Cooking Wine
1 pound boneless chicken breasts, skinned
1 cup pea pods, blanched
¾ cup sliced celery
¼ cup sliced green onions
½ cup mayonnaise
1 teaspoon grated lemon peel
1 pinch Pepper if desired
½ cup toasted slivered almonds
Lettuce

Steps:

  • Place cooking wine and chicken in large saucepan. Add enough water to cover. Bring to a boil; reduce heat. Simmer 10 minutes or until chicken is tender and no longer pink.
  • Let chicken cool in liquid 45 minutes. Drain; cut chicken into bite-sized pieces.
  • In large bowl, combine chicken, pea pods, celery, onions, mayonnaise, lemon peel and pepper; mix well. Cover; refrigerate 1 to 2 hours to blend flavors.
  • Just before serving, stir in almonds. To serve, spoon chicken salad onto lettuce-lined plates.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 479.5 calories, Carbohydrate 11 g, Cholesterol 67.4 mg, Fat 34.6 g, Fiber 4.1 g, Protein 26.4 g, SaturatedFat 5.4 g, Sodium 419.4 mg, Sugar 1.9 g
